AMHERST — The executive director for the Belchertown Housing Authority is one of two finalists being considered to become the next leader for the Amherst Housing Authority.

A search committee this week tapped Pamela Rogers, who has been in charge in Belchertown, and Carlos Lopez, executive director of the Westerly, Rhode Island Housing Authority, to be publicly interviewed.

Lopez and Rogers are candidates to replace Debra “Debbie” Turgeon, who resigned in May from the position she held since January 2017.

Interviews are scheduled for Wednesday at the community room on the fifth floor at Ann Whalen Apartments, the first at noon and the second at 4 p.m.

Since Turgeon departed, Pam Parmakian, director of housing programs, has been the interim executive director of the Amherst Housing Authority, which has nearly 200 units of low-income public housing.
